WebAug 7, 2024 · Can kale cause blood clots? Blood thinners: Kale is a rich source of vitamin K, which contributes to blood clotting. This could interfere with the activity of blood thinners, such as warfarin (Coumadin). ... Does broccoli affect blood clotting? Broccoli doesn’t thin your blood, but the vitamin K in broccoli can inhibit your anticoagulant ...
